The Importance of Security When Selling Your Garage

When selling a garage, security is an important consideration for both you and the buyer. Whether you’re selling to a private buyer or a professional garage buyer, ensuring the security of the property during the sale is crucial. Here’s why security matters and how to address it when selling your garage.



1. A Secure Garage Attracts Serious Buyers


Serious buyers want to know that their new garage will be safe and secure. If your garage has adequate security features like strong locks, security cameras, and well-lit entrances, it will appeal to buyers looking for a safe space for their vehicles or storage.



2. Ensure Access Control


A buyer will be more interested in purchasing a garage that has controlled access. Make sure that any doors or gates are functional and secure. If you have keyless entry or a secure remote access system, highlight this feature when advertising your garage for sale.



3. Address Any Potential Security Issues


If your garage has security issues, such as broken locks or poor lighting, it’s important to fix them before listing the property. A garage that is not secure can reduce its value and may prevent serious buyers from making an offer.



4. Be Transparent About Security Features


When selling your garage, make sure to disclose any security features you have in place. If you’ve invested in security upgrades like an alarm system or surveillance cameras, be sure to mention these in your listing to attract buyers who prioritize safety.



5. Offer Security Documentation


If you’ve made any security upgrades, provide documentation to the buyer. This can include receipts for new locks, alarm systems, or cameras. This documentation gives buyers confidence that the garage is secure and well-maintained.
